Ashoka University has recently strengthened its decade-long partnership with the University of Pennsylvania, aiming to create transformative opportunities for students in science and technology. This collaboration, highlighted by the Ashoka University 4+1 master’s pathway with Penn Engineering, is designed to offer students accelerated academic programs, immersive research experiences, and interdisciplinary education. By enabling a streamlined transition from undergraduate to graduate studies, this program underscores Ashoka’s commitment to providing world-class academic exposure for Indian and international students.


A Transformative Academic Partnership

Since its inception, the collaboration between Ashoka University and Penn has emphasized global academic mobility, research innovation, and cross-disciplinary learning. The Ashoka University 4+1 master’s pathway with Penn Engineering offers students an opportunity to complete a bachelor’s degree at Ashoka and transition seamlessly into a master’s program at Penn’s School of Engineering and Applied Science. This unique pathway integrates rigorous coursework, mentorship from leading faculty, and access to advanced laboratory facilities.

The program also fosters collaboration across fields such as artificial intelligence, data science, sustainability, and robotics, enabling students to contribute to solving pressing global challenges. By combining Ashoka’s liberal arts education with Penn’s technical expertise, participants gain a competitive edge in the global job market and research community.
